Are they recommending the jab for people with compromised immune systems?  I read somewhere they weren't.

Quote:
Certain diseases or conditions may cause a weakened immune system placing people at greater risk of suffering complications if they become sick from COVID-19.  These include:

    heart disease
    chronic lung diseases, such as ch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D) and cystic fibrosis
    kidney disease
    poorly controlled diabetes
    poorly controlled hypertension
    cancer
    moderate to severe asthma
    genetic immune deficiencies.
